  • Lucinda Williams Tribute

    Carolyn Young and West Seventh will be performing a number of popular and deep cuts from the Lucinda Williams catalog.  The West Seventh band will feature Mary Cutrefello on guitar, with an opening set featuring Lori Goulet Reich.
